We’re Ready to Assist You
Feel free to contact Texas Tower Passport and Visa Services whenever you need information or for any and all of your travel needs. We specialize in individual clients but welcome corporations and travel agencies. Please contact us for any of our special discounts on group travel.
Full Contact Information
Mailing Address
Texas Tower Passport and Visa Services
2020 Montrose Blvd.
Suite 400
Houston, TX 77006
Phone, Fax and Email
Toll-Free: (855) 715-1062
Local Phone: (713) 874-1420
Fax: (713) 874-1245
Email: info@texastower.net